Compilation of unsettling short films where the goal is to entertain idiots. However, the twist lies in the production itself, as the creators realize that entertaining an idiot is harder than it seems.
2025
1912
2023
1897
2020
2017
—
1960
1967
1989
2021
2010
2024
1988
2007